blob: 2e6974777915eb65ac8f4080163d74a944d6e2ec [file] [log] [blame] [edit]
[package]
name = "libchromeos"
version = "0.1.0"
authors = ["The ChromiumOS Authors"]
edition = "2021"
[build-dependencies]
pkg-config = { version = "0.3.11", optional = true }
[dependencies]
dbus = { version = "0.9", optional = true }
libc = "0.2"
log = "0.4"
multi_log = "0.1.2"
nix = { version = "0.26", features = ["signal"] }
poll_token_derive = { path = "./poll_token_derive" } # provided by ebuild
serde = { version = "1.0.114", features = ["derive"] }
stderrlog = "0.5.0"
syslog = "6.0.1"
system_api = { path = "../system_api", optional = true } # provided by ebuild
tempfile = "3"
thiserror = "1.0.20"
vboot_reference-sys = { path = "../../platform/vboot_reference/rust/vboot_reference-sys", optional = true } # provided by ebuild
zeroize = { version = "1.2.0", features = ["zeroize_derive"] }
[features]
default = []
chromeos-module = ["dbus", "pkg-config", "system_api", "vboot_reference-sys"]